Hi my name is Rose and I am a sustainable fashion designer based in North Wales UK. On social media, I share eco-fashion process videos and sewing techniques to educate my creative community and encourage sustainability conversations. I have repurposed bowling shoes into trousers, sneakers into gloves and upcycle as much as i can. I also run a small business where i handmake and sell reflective accessories, while practicing zero waste and pushing the boundaries of unconventional materials.

Maritime Sunburst

Category: Apparel

Competitions: Fashion

‘Maritime Sunburst’ is a project that upcycles bleach stained and distressed hair dresser towels for Spring/Summer 2024. Inspired by 1950s hair salon culture and the lichen Xanthoria parietina (Maritime Sunburst), the concept captures a feeling of freedom and fun in the sunshine. The textile’s natural drying properties makes the apparel functional by keeping you dry on the go and the natural signs of wear and frayed finish creates a grunge streetstyle look. Within the fibres lie many stories of happy customers showing off their brand-new hairstyles and identities. But now instead of ending up in landfill, the cloth lives on to experience many more stories to come. From beauty to beach to bistro, these pieces pave the way from beach coverup to something stylish and wearable while walking the promenade.
